The basic principle of steam sterilization, as accomplished in an autoclave, is to expose each item to direct steam contact at the required temperature and pressure for the specified time. Air is rapidly removed from the load as with the prevacuum sterilizer, but air leaks do not affect this process because the steam in the sterilizing chamber is always above atmospheric pressure. The effectiveness of steam sterilization is monitored with a biological indicator containing spores ofGeobacillus stearothermophilus(formerlyBacillus stearothermophilus).
